1. An automated process for converting biological samples into an output format suitable for further analysis, the process comprising:

  • receiving a plurality of tube strips in one or more tube strip racks, each tube strip having a plurality of sample tubes with a respective sample in each tube;

    transferring a group of tube strips from the one or more tube strip racks to a tube strip holder, the tube strip holder having plurality of wells configured to each hold at least one tube strip;

    dispensing a sample conversion buffer into each sample tube in the group of tube strips;

    shaking the tube strip holder a first time to simultaneously mix the contents of each sample tube in the tube strip holder;

    centrifuging the tube strip holder to simultaneously centrifuge the contents of each sample tube in the tube strip holder;

    removing a liquid supernatant from each sample tube in the tube strip holder;

    moving the tube strip holder to an inspection station;

    simultaneously inspecting the contents of each tube in the tube strip holder to determine whether a pellet has formed in each tube in the tube strip holder;

    dispensing a specimen transport medium and a denaturation reagent into each tube in the tube strip holder;

    shaking the tube strip holder a second time to simultaneously mix the contents of each sample tube in the tube strip holder;

    heating the tube strip holder for a first length of time to simultaneously incubate the contents of each sample tube in the tube strip holder;

    shaking the tube strip holder a third time to simultaneously mix the contents of each sample tube in the tube strip holder;

    heating the tube strip holder for a second length of time to simultaneously incubate the contents of each sample tube in the tube strip holder;

    shaking the tube strip holder a fourth time to simultaneously mix the contents of each sample tube in the tube strip holder; and

    transferring at least a portion of each sample to a respective well on an output plate.
